Page MenuHomeSolus

The inclusion of i2pd fixes T6642
ClosedPublic

Authored by Devil505 on Aug 16 2018, 5:20 AM.
Tags
None
Referenced Files
F11038441: D3604.id8912.diff
Wed, Aug 9, 10:41 PM
F11038440: D3604.id8991.diff
Wed, Aug 9, 10:41 PM
F11038439: D3604.id.diff
Wed, Aug 9, 10:41 PM
F11027481: D3604.diff
Wed, Aug 9, 4:26 AM
F10942158: D3604.id.diff
Fri, Jul 14, 9:44 AM
F10942134: D3604.id.diff
Fri, Jul 14, 9:34 AM
F10895830: D3604.diff
Jul 1 2023, 7:42 PM
F10830023: D3604.id8991.diff
Jun 4 2023, 4:26 PM
Subscribers

Details

Test Plan

Launch i2pd command via sudo, with your browser, enable proxy with 127.0.0.1 and port 4444.
Then browse for example to www.i2pd.i2p or www.inr.i2p (with this last one you can see the list of i2p hosts)

Diff Detail

Branch
master
Lint
No Lint Coverage
Unit
No Test Coverage

Event Timeline

I need some advice:

  • %make_install install i2pd in /usr/bin but the systemd service provided refers to /usr/sbin, this is why I manually install i2pd in /usr/sbin
  • sudo systemctl start i2pd.service gives errors like:
Starting I2P Router written in C++...
i2pd.service: Failed to determine user credentials: No such process
i2pd.service: Failed at step USER spawning /usr/sbin/i2pd: No such process
i2pd.service: Control process exited, code=exited status=217
i2pd.service: Failed with result 'exit-code'.
Failed to start I2P Router written in C++.
DataDrake added a subscriber: DataDrake.

Makes sense. LGTM. Thanks!

This revision is now accepted and ready to land.Aug 18 2018, 11:54 PM
This revision was automatically updated to reflect the committed changes.

I'll fix it this time, but you really need to include abi_used_libs